From check-in to check-out, our stay was unexpectedly extraordinary and efficient. The location on the outskirts of Prague may seem to be out of the way but the 2-3 minute walk to the train station makes central Prague only a 15 minute ride away. (We didn't even hear the trains in our rooms.) It also makes the price unbeatable. Our two bedroom suite (three beds with fans) was clean and comfortable. The check-in online through the Alfred app and in-person was simple and efficient. The restaurant has delicious fried cheese and breakfast has more variety than a typical continental breakfast. There is secure parking in the courtyard, as well as good seating for drinks and a playground for kids. An extra kudos to Susanne, who facilitated our check-in, gave us valuable guidance to get around, and even saved some extra eggs for my children's breakfast!

The hotel is some distance from the city centre but is served by excellent bus and rail links, both being a short walk away. The area is very quiet. The hotel is very clean, staff were all welcoming and polite. I had a single room which was simple in set up but was everything I needed. It was clean with fresh towels and bed linen. The shower was excellent. Breakfast was European buffet style and was simple but did the job. They have a small bar with good beer and a small menu. I had 'Tacos' which was actually a chicken wrap, very tasty and a great price. I would recommend the hotel for people who are traveling light and don't mind utilising Prague's excellent transport system.

Friendly and helpful staff (limited English); freshly painted and furnished. Had a lovely restaraunt where we ate delicious meals drank local wine and beer for very inexpensive price. They had a seven piece jazz band playing that night and quite a few locals came to dine and dance. It was a beautiful night to be a part of. Lovely dance floor with tables around the edge of the room. The motel room was very quiet, in spite of the jazz band playing. The furniture in the rooms was solid and attractive. Our bedding and the floor we were on did smell a bit of cigarette smoke, though our kids were on the top floor and could not smell it. On the stair well, the walls are decorated with pictures and there are an attractive arrangement of pot plants and interesting pieces of furniture. On the top floor the room our kids had was quite spacious and had a separate living room from the bed room and bath room. Breakfast, included in the price, a self-serve buffet with wide range of choice. We asked at reception about the best way to get to the centre and were told the train and given a map. A very short walk down a lane to the railway station, only three stops into the centre of Prague (took 15 minutes and cost a very small amount) We walked to the old town centre, across the fabulous Charles Bridge to the Palace. We thoroughly enjoyed our stay in Prague and at the Hotel Svornost and highly recommend it. A lot of effort has been made to make the hotel pleasant and comfortable
